        As of 12:46 pm, the Hockey East Athletic Directors were still in a confeer
ence call to decide Maine's punishment for Patrice Tardif's ineligibility. I'll have a report when BU sports Informan
        I'll have a report when I hear from BU sports info what's going on.
        They are discussing three remedies:
        1. Maine forfeits all games and plays BU in the first round of HE tourney
        2. Maine forfeits all games and is banned from HE tourney
        3. Do nothing and let NCAA deal with it.
 
        I should know within the next couple of hours what's going on.
